Ticket #— Floor 9 Opening Prep, Brindlemoor House

Hi facilities folks, Floor 9 opens to staff next Monday and we need a few things squared away before then. Lift access is live, but the two side doors by the kitchenette are still on the old lock config — please reprogram them before Friday. Also, signage for the quiet rooms hasn't arrived, so pop up the temporary printed ones for now. Until the badge readers sync, the interim door code for Floor 9 is below.

door code, bajop-bajog: bdg-DSWAC-43621

Leadership Review Briefing — Closure of the Dunholm Satellite Office. Prepared for the finance team of Ardent Clearwater Ltd. The Dunholm office, opened as a pilot site three years ago, has not met occupancy or revenue targets, and the lease break clause becomes exercisable next quarter. Staff will be offered relocation to the Ferncliff hub or remote arrangements. Finance should model exit costs, including dilapidations and severance provisions, ahead of the review. Broader context appears in the confidential note below.

management briefing: Project Ulavan slips by two quarters because of the staffing delay.

Tenants on the Meridian plan were throttled at the default 100 req/min instead of their contracted 5,000, producing a spike of 429s lasting eleven minutes. We confirmed the crash by correlating warmer heartbeats with the first throttle events, then restarted the warmer with the supervisor flag enabled. For the reviewer: the exact deploy that introduced the unsupervised warmer is recorded below.

pipeline stamp: htk9_ce63042d9